Energetic ventilation distributes by actively drawing outside air right into your home and pushing inside air out of your home. Easy air flow flows utilizing all-natural pressures like wind and thermal buoyancy. Easy ventilation is a greener alternative, yet it is not as constant as energetic air flow.

A complete roofing system replacement is simply what it sounds like: complete. Unlike re-roofing, which includes laying down a new layer of roof shingles on top of your old roof covering material, a total roof covering substitute entails tearing off every layer of your roofing system and replacing it. find out This is why some companies call it a "tear-off" roof.


Decking: The outdoor decking is a considerable layer of security for your home, usually consisting of a collection of level boards affixed to the joists or trusses - Roofing contractor Nebraska.


Examine This Report on Weathercraft


Underlayment: This vital layer goes in-between the outdoor decking and the roof shingles. Underlayment is a water-proof or water-resistant layer affixed directly to the roofing deck, and uses an extra degree of security from extreme climate. Flashing: A slim but vital roofing component, blinking is made use of to guide water away from vulnerable areas of the roofing, especially where a section of roofing satisfies an upright surface like a wall or chimney.
